Carlos Alcaraz defeats Novak Djokovic to win Wimbledon championship – News

In an epic showdown at the Wimbledon final, Spain’s Carlos Alcaraz showcased his dominance as he defeated Serbia’s Novak Djokovic in straight sets, securing his second consecutive Wimbledon title. Alcaraz’s impeccable performance led to a 6-2 6-2 7-6(4) victory over Djokovic, denying the Serbian player his 25th Grand Slam title and the chance to surpass Margaret Court’s record. With this win, Alcaraz now boasts four Grand Slam titles with a flawless record in major finals, adding to his two Wimbledon triumphs, his US Open victory in 2022, and his French Open win last month.

From the opening game, Alcaraz displayed his determination and skill as he seized control of the match, breaking Djokovic in a marathon 14-minute game. The 21-year-old’s powerful serving and relentless play allowed him to storm through the first set and establish an early lead. Djokovic, the second seed, struggled to keep up with Alcaraz’s aggressive tactics in the second set, leading to another break and an imposing two-set advantage for the young Spaniard.

As the match progressed, Djokovic fought back, pushing Alcaraz to a tiebreak in the third set after some intense exchanges between the two players. Despite squandering three match points and dropping serve while leading 5-4, Alcaraz managed to regain his composure and secure victory in the tiebreak with a decisive return that clinched the title for him. This triumph marks another milestone in Alcaraz’s career and solidifies his position as a rising star in the world of tennis.

Alcaraz’s remarkable success at Wimbledon not only showcased his exceptional talent and skill on the court but also highlighted his mental fortitude and composure under pressure. By defeating an illustrious opponent like Djokovic in such a convincing manner, Alcaraz has proven that he belongs among the elite players in the sport. His ability to stay focused and deliver top-notch performances in high-stakes matches bodes well for his future in tennis and sets the stage for potentially more Grand Slam titles in the years to come.

The impact of Alcaraz’s win at Wimbledon extends beyond his personal achievements, as it also reshapes the landscape of men’s singles tennis and the race for Grand Slam titles. With Djokovic’s quest for a record-breaking 25th Grand Slam title falling short, the competition among top players intensifies, creating a thrilling narrative for fans and spectators. Alcaraz’s emergence as a formidable contender adds depth and excitement to the sport, setting the stage for compelling rivalries and matchups in the upcoming tournaments.

In conclusion, Carlos Alcaraz’s stunning victory at the Wimbledon final against Novak Djokovic has left a lasting impact on the tennis world, solidifying his status as a rising star and a force to be reckoned with. His flawless performance, mental strength, and composure under pressure have set him apart as a top contender in the sport, with his potential for future success shining bright. As Alcaraz continues to make waves in the tennis scene, fans can look forward to witnessing more thrilling matches and memorable moments from this young phenom in the years to come.
